Driver faces DUI charge after I-89 crash in Colchester

COLCHESTER — A St. Albans woman was arrested on suspicion of driving under the influence after her vehicle crashed on Interstate 89 in Colchester Sunday evening.

Vermont State Police responded to a single-vehicle crash at approximately 6:10 p.m. on April 27 near mile marker 96 on I-89 northbound.

Troopers identified the driver as Megan Eddy, 36, of St. Albans.

According to police, Eddy was traveling northbound when her vehicle left the roadway and entered the median, causing all airbags to deploy and resulting in severe front-end damage to her 2014 Mazda Mz2.

While speaking with Eddy, troopers observed signs of impairment, police said.

No injuries were reported in the crash.

Eddy was arrested and transported to the Williston Barracks for processing.

She was later released with a citation to appear at Chittenden County Superior Court on May 15 at 8:30 a.m. to answer to the charge of DUI, first offense.
